What Is Business Software?

Business software is a set of computer programs that streamlines and streamlines the company’s business processes. This enables the business to work more efficiently, and without mistakes. These software tools are often employed to handle a variety of website functions, such as bookkeeping and accounting and billing, asset management desktop publishing, payroll management. They can be bought or developed in-house but they can also be purchased as off-the-shelf (OTS) products and are typically installed on desktop computers, or large servers.

Cloud computing has revolutionized how businesses use software. It decreases the need for expensive infrastructure and enables easy integration with other tools. Artificial intelligence (AI) machine learning, and various other emerging technologies are also changing the business process by automating the tasks and improving data analysis.

Software tools can be influenced by the needs of a particular industry. For example, a tool to track customer interactions and stock rotation might be more crucial for certain companies than others, based on the type of goods or services offered.

Other options to consider include documents creation and organization tools, time-tracking apps and collaboration and communication platforms like Google Workspace or Trello.
